With its big booths, huge steer horns over the bar, and cowboy gear adorning the walls, this restaurant looks like a glorified cowboy steakhouse -- but this is big flavor country, and the menu isn't the sort any real cowboy would likely have anything to do with. Start out with fried cactus strips with black-bean gravy or perhaps a rattlesnake brochette. For an entree, be sure to try the buffalo sirloin, which is served with some flavorful sauce of the moment. At lunch, try the buffalo burger. Service is relaxed and friendly. The adjacent Silver Saddle Room is a more upscale spin on the same concept, with similar menu prices. It was in this building in 1965 that the Cowboy Artists of America organization was formed. The kids should get a kick out of the cowboy decor and, who knows, you may even get them to taste your rattlesnake or cactus appetizer.
